First 8A by Holly McMullen

Holly McMullen has after just over two years of climbing done her first 8A, Gross's Roof in Cumberland. No secret, sport or finger instrument background. The first summer was spent on a finger board as she was to poor paying the gym entrance after finishing college studies. "I know plenty of people here in the south that have not been climbing long and are getting strong quick! It's just easier now with so many climbing gyms and training tools available. My goals don't really revolve around certain climbs right now, I mean, I have a ticklist, but I'm just psyched to improve on my weaknesses and travel. More info at Hollyclimbs.blogspot.com
